CHAPTER 836.
(House Bill 743)

AN ACT to repeal and re-enact, with amendments, Section 11
of Article 64A of the Annotated Code of Maryland (1939
Edition), title "Merit System", relating to the publication
of notice of examinations for positions in the classified
service.

SECTION 1.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Mary-
land, That Section 11 of Article 64A of the Annotated Code
of Maryland (1939 Edition), title "Merit System", be and it
is hereby repealed and re-enacted, with amendments, to read
as follows:

11. Notice of every open examination scheduled by the
Commissioner shall be published with the closing date
for receiving applications and the rate of compensation
for each position listed at least once a week for at
least two successive weeks preceding the examination in
a newspaper or newspapers of general circulation in the
City of Baltimore or in the county in which the examination
is to be held. Such notice shall also be sent to the Clerk
of the Superior Court of Baltimore City and to the Clerk of
the Circuit Court for each county in this State, and said
Clerks shall forthwith post the same in their respective
Court "Houses. Such further notice shall be given as the
Commissioner may prescribe. The Commissioner shall, when-
ever necessary, provide facilities for holding examinations
in different parts of the State.

SEC. 2. And be it further enacted, That this Act shall take
effect June 1, 1947.

Approved April 25, 1947.
